The answer to 'how much does wildlife removal cost local' is that the cost can vary significantly depending on your location, the type of wildlife, and the complexity of the removal. As a general guideline, wildlife removal services typically range from $100 to $500 or more for a single incident.
The key factors that influence the cost include the animal species, the extent of the infestation, the accessibility of the problem area, and whether any structural damage needs to be repaired. Larger animals like raccoons or opossums usually cost more to remove than smaller pests like mice or squirrels. Additionally, if the wildlife has caused damage to your home, the repair costs can add significantly to the overall price.
